Is Playboy selling itself? Company reportedly in talks with Iconix

Updated

Playboy Enterprises's (PLA) shares soared more than 60% after Bloomberg News reported that the pioneering adult publisher was in talks to sell itself to Iconix Brand Group (ICON), the owner of Candie's and London Fog clothing brands. The news may sit well with investors now, but if it really happens, it could mean the end of Playboy magazine as we know it.

News that the Chicago-based company may be seeking a suitor is hardly a shock. Longtime CEO Christie Hefner, the daughter of company founder/icon Hugh Hefner, was forced out after failing to stem losses at the flagship magazine. Bloomberg reports that the board has been looking for a buyer since June, when it hired Freedom Communications CEO Scott Flanders, to replace Christie Hefner. Both Playboy and Iconix declined to comment on reports of a possible sale.
